WHY STEEL?

It is more isotropic and high-strength material than wood and concrete. The modulus of elasticity is 11,000 in wood (pine), 30,000 in concrete (c20) and 200,000 in steel (S235JR). In other words, 18 times the wood, 7 times the reinforced concrete. Therefore, it makes less deflection and requires less material.

Human errors in manufacturing and assembly of steel construction are minimized. So strength in construction; concrete, formwork, iron workers are not left to the initiative. Human errors are minimized. Larger openings can be crossed with lighter materials.

It is useful to remind that; tensile and bending loads due to torque are met by steel material in most of the structural elements passing through the opening. It can respond perfectly to architectural geometries in various ways while preserving the desired strength and aesthetics. Since most of the projects are completed in our factory; As the labor force is used more efficiently during installation at the construction site, working times are shortened and costs can be reduced.

STEEL ROOFS

Steel roofs are much lighter than reinforced concrete roofs. They reduce the equivalent earthquake forces acting due to their light weight. It enables the passage of wide openings. In this case, the volume to be created increases and more spacious areas can be created.
